Uttar Pradesh: Road accident kills five, injures 24

May 18, 2019, at 10:45 am

Unnao, May 18 (UNI): At least five people were killed while 24 others sustained injuries,when a luxury bus overturned after hitting a tractor trolley in Bangarmau area of the district on Agra-Lucknow Expressway early on Saturday morning.

Uttar Pradesh: Three killed, four injured in road mishap

Apr 13, 2019, at 03:36 pm

Lakhimpur Kheri, Apr 13 (UNI) Three people died and four others sustained serious injuries after a speeding car rammed into a tree before hitting a truck at the Paliya National Highway in Phulbehar area district of Uttar Pradesh on Saturday, police said.

UP police allegedly deny help to road accident victims who later succumb to injuries

Jan 20, 2018, at 09:57 pm

Saharanpur, Jan 20 (IBNS): Three policemen in Saharanpur, Uttar Pradesh, were suspended after it came to light that they had refused to shift two grievously injured person to the hospital, who later succumbed to their injuries, according to media reports on Saturday.
